In a shocking turn of events, the Christian Democratic Union (CDU) headquarters in Winterhude, Hamburg, has been targeted in a colour attack. According to reports, red paint was splattered on the facade of the building, causing significant damage.

The CDU spokesman confirmed the incident, adding that the police are currently investigating the matter. State chairman Dennis Thering strongly condemned the attack, describing it as a disgrace. He stated that those who believe colour attacks can decide political debates are mistaken.

This is not the first time the CDU headquarters in Hamburg has been a target of such attacks. During the state election campaign, the building was previously vandalised with paint. The latest attack occurred in the Leinpfad area, and no further details about the nature of the attack or the suspects involved have been provided. Thering, in response to the attack, expressed his disappointment and called for a peaceful and respectful discourse in political debates.

A slogan was found on the facade of the CDU headquarters, but no further details about its meaning were provided in the article.
